Celtic and Rangers are usually up towards the top of the outright Scottish League Cup betting market. That's understandable given they have won the title over 40 times between them.

Cup soccer is never straight forward, however, as teams from lower down the league ladder can upset the so-called big boys on their day. And, with the likes of St Johnstone, Ross County and Aberdeen lifting the trophy in recent years, it shows that you can find value away from the Old Firm in the Scottish League Cup odds.

Who won the Scottish League Cup last season?

St Johnstone are the most recent winners of the Scottish League Cup. Led by manager Callum Davidson, the Saints lifted the trophy for the first time in their history in the 2020/21 season.

The Perth based outfit topped a group containing Dundee United, Peterhead, Kelty Hearts, and Brechin City after winning three of their four games. They then went on to defeat Motherwell, Dunfermline and Hibernian in the knockout rounds to set up a final against Livingston.

It was a tight final at Hampden Park, with St Johnstone claiming a 1-0 win thanks to a 32nd minute goal from Shaun Rooney.
